we are developing a I2C to 1-wire interface board with one I2C bus and for three 1-wire segments. Because the 1-wire master DS2484 has a fixed I2C address, can we use it together with the I2C address translator LTC4317 ? That means for one DS2484 the I2C is connected direct, and the other 2 DS2484 via your double I2C address translator LTC4317. Is there expierence with such a solution?
 
Because we need the advance capabilities of the DS2484 we can't use a DS2482-100 as 1w master, where we can select different addresses.
